Los Angeles city and county officials share updates on the devastating wildfires sweeping through California during a press briefing on January 8. Mayor Karen Bass highlights the catastrophic nature of the fires, describing them as the "big one in magnitude". She explains that hurricane-force winds, typically accompanied by rainstorms, are now paired with extremely dry drought conditions, making the situation unique and severe. The mayor urges residents to evacuate promptly if instructed, warning that more evacuation orders may follow overnight.
The wildfires continue to rage around Los Angeles, claiming at least five lives and destroying hundreds of homes. Firefighting resources and water supplies face immense strain, as state officials report that most fires remain 0% contained. Over 100,000 residents are ordered to evacuate to ensure their safety.
